The 29th Anniversary of DDT was also the first attempt by KANON to try and win the KO-D Openweight Title. For the weeks leading up to this match, KANON had been winning matches with the Lariat so Yuki Ueno tried to weaken it by hitting KANON’s hand off the corner post early on. KANON would still use the Lariat as an equalizer but then tried using his other moves to win. The Cobra Twist, Sleepy Hollow and LONELY DEZIRES wouldn’t work so he went back to the Lariat. However Ueno’s well time Dropkick to the face helped him to set up the Blackout Sleeper to squeeze the life out of KANON. While he was eventually able to get out of it, KANON was then given the WR to put him down and out.

Ueno told KANON after the match that he’s been thinking about him a lot. He thinks KANON is strong, handsome, kind and also weird. If he wants to make it to the top of DDT he cannot stay the way he is now. KANON needs to show more. Still, Ueno had fun and reminded KANON he’s been part of the DDT family even going back to when he was part of DAMNATION T.A. When he was done, Yuki Iino got into the ring feeling moved by Ueno’s speech. Iino asked for a title match because Ueno was his senior who taught him everything about pro wrestling back when Iino was a trainee. Ueno was also Iino’s first ever opponent. Ueno said he would accept the challenge on the condition that Iino would not immediately attack him after they shake hands. Iino agreed and they shook hands without incident. Ueno then told the fans he will carry the hopes of everybody as DDT moves into its 30th year.

In an unfortunate turn of events, TNA have told Tokyo Joshi Pro that Lei Ying Lee is unable to take part at their Sumo Hall show and her scheduled trip to Japan has been cancelled. Despite having the booking placed well in advance, TJPW were unable to convince TNA to change their decision. Instead, TNA provided TJPW with a statement that claims neither TJPW nor Lee are to blame over the situation. As best as I can tell, TNA have their “SACRIFICE” special as well as a TV taping happening in New Orleans during the same weekend as “GRAND PRINCESS ’26”. So if Lee is needed for the TV taping on the Saturday then she definitely can’t make it to Tokyo in time for TJPW on the Sunday. The time difference probably makes it too difficult for her to start travelling on the Friday night too. Plus there’s also the general travel risks from going in and out of America that’s currently happening right now that could be playing a part in this situation.

TJPW were quick to announce Lee’s replacement after they put that news out. They put out an offer to Marvelous to secure the TJPW debut of Takumi Iroha! She will be teaming up with Sareee which means their tag team Spark Rush is coming to TJPW! Chris Brookes was feeling down over his recent championship defeats but a brand new opponent emerging in Baka Gaijin + Friends has cheered him up. Yuta Oya is from Sportiva Entertainment and only debuted in July 2024 which made headlines because he is blind. He had cancer as a child that resulted in his right eye being removed and radiation therapy being needed to save his left eye. He had taken up judo in school and wanted to become a pro wrestler but had to give up that dream when he eventually lost sight in his left eye and became fully blind. He was then diagnosed with bladder cancer in his early 30s which made him want to become a pro wrestler to teach his son you need the determination to never give up while pursuing what you love.

The DDT 29th Anniversary main event has been set. Yuki Ueno defends the KO-D Openweight Title against KANON in a match that has more history behind it than it looks on the surface. When KANON joined DDT in 2022 his first loss in the company was to Ueno in that year’s King Of DDT tournament. KANON wants to get revenge on that loss while also taking the company’s top prize as somebody who has grown to love DDT. Ueno remembers that match and he also remembers all of the times KANON tried to hurt him as a member of DAMNATION T.A. Will the build up to this match result in fresh bad blood between them or will cooler heads prevail to focus on the big prize?
